原神启动项目技术文档
www-genshin 项目地址: https://gitcode.com/gh_mirrors/ww/www-genshin
1. 安装指南
1.1 环境准备
在开始安装之前,请确保您的开发环境已经安装了以下工具:
- Node.js(建议版本14.x及以上)
- npm(Node.js自带,建议版本6.x及以上)
1.2 安装依赖
- 克隆项目仓库到本地:
git clone https://github.com/your-repo/genshin-start.git
- 进入项目目录:
cd genshin-start
- 安装项目依赖:
如果npm安装速度较慢,可以使用cnpm进行安装:npm install
cnpm install
2. 项目的使用说明
2.1 启动项目
在项目根目录下运行以下命令启动项目:
npm start
启动成功后,项目将在本地服务器上运行,默认访问地址为http://localhost:3000
。
2.2 项目结构
项目的主要目录结构如下:
genshin-start/
├── src/
│ ├── assets/
│ ├── components/
│ ├── styles/
│ ├── index.js
├── public/
│ ├── index.html
├── package.json
├── README.md
src/
:包含项目的源代码。public/
:包含静态资源文件。package.json
:项目的依赖配置文件。
2.3 注意事项
- 本项目是一个技术示例,仅供学习和研究使用,请勿用于商业用途。
- 由于项目与《原神》较为相似,请勿将本项目用于不正当用途。
3. 项目API使用文档
3.1 xviewer.js
xviewer.js
是一个基于three.js
的插件式渲染框架,它对three.js
进行了封装,提供了大量实用的组件和插件,使得前端开发者能更简单地应用WebGL技术。
3.2 主要API
xviewer.init()
:初始化xviewer.js环境。xviewer.loadScene(sceneConfig)
:加载场景配置。xviewer.addObject(objectConfig)
:添加3D对象。xviewer.render()
:渲染场景。
3.3 示例代码
import xviewer from 'xviewer.js';
xviewer.init();
const sceneConfig = {
backgroundColor: 0x000000,
cameraPosition: [0, 0, 10]
};
xviewer.loadScene(sceneConfig);
const objectConfig = {
type: 'sphere',
position: [0, 0, 0],
radius: 1
};
xviewer.addObject(objectConfig);
xviewer.render();
4. 项目安装方式
4.1 通过npm安装
npm install genshin-start
4.2 通过git克隆
git clone https://github.com/your-repo/genshin-start.git
4.3 手动下载
您也可以直接从GitHub仓库下载项目的ZIP文件,解压后按照安装指南进行安装。
以上是关于《原神启动》项目的技术文档,希望对您的使用有所帮助。如果您有任何问题或建议,欢迎在交流群中提出。
www-genshin 项目地址: https://gitcode.com/gh_mirrors/ww/www-genshin
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考